Transaction 8429787e53332ec26ad7fe6e03ab811501cf812606f25abf68f8d911b5231868
1 Input
1 Output
-
8429787e53332ec26ad7fe6e03ab811501cf812606f25abf68f8d911b5231868:0
- value
- 474537
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a93a7f7b6fade2c7e4c42fcda38cf94a1c8b9bd
- address
- bc1q82f60aaklt0zcljvgt7d5wx0jjsu3wda9u4dxn